Spencer Lane was a 16-year-old rising figure skating star from Barrington, Rhode Island, whose promising career was tragically cut short in a plane crash in Washington, D.C., on January 29, 2025. He was returning home from the U.S. Figure Skating Championships and a national developmental camp in Wichita, Kansas, when his American Airlines Flight 5342 collided midair with a U.S. Army Black Hawk helicopter.

A dedicated athlete, Spencer was known for his fearless skating style, charisma, and passion for the sport. He had thousands of social media followers and frequently shared his skating progress online. His final TikTok video showed him landing a triple toe loop, just hours before the tragic accident.

Early Life and Skating Career

Spencer Lane was born in 2008 and grew up in Barrington, Rhode Island. From a young age, he displayed immense passion and talent for figure skating, dedicating countless hours to training.

  • He initially trained at Warwick Figure Skaters and later joined the Skating Club of Boston, one of the most prestigious skating clubs in the United States.
  • Spencer’s skills rapidly progressed, earning him a spot at the National Development Camp in Wichita, Kansas, in 2025.
  • He competed in regional and national competitions, and many in the skating community saw him as a future Olympian.
  • His fearless approach to skating and dedication to mastering complex jumps set him apart from his peers.

Spencer left Barrington High School to focus entirely on skating, a testament to his commitment to the sport.

Plane Crash & Tragic Death (January 29, 2025)

What Happened to Spencer Lane?

On January 29, 2025, Spencer and his mother, Christine Conrad Lane (49), were aboard American Airlines Flight 5342, returning from the National Development Camp in Wichita, Kansas.

  • The flight was operated by PSA Airlines as American Eagle CRJ-700.
  • At 9:00 PM (local time), the plane collided midair with a U.S. Army Black Hawk helicopter while approaching Washington, D.C.’s Reagan National Airport.
  • All 60 passengers and 4 crew members died, including 14 figure skaters, their families, and coaches.
  • Spencer was traveling with his coach and 1994 World Champions, Vadim Naumov and Evgenia Shishkova, who also died in the crash.

The tragic accident devastated the U.S. figure skating community, as many of the victims were young up-and-coming athletes.


Family and Personal Life

Spencer Lane was adopted from South Korea as a baby by Douglas Lane and Christine Conrad Lane. He grew up with his younger brother, Milo.

- Advertisement -
  • His mother, Christine Lane, was a graphic designer, animal lover, and creative spirit.
  • His father, Douglas Lane, described Spencer as a force of nature and an unstoppable talent in figure skating.
  • The Lane family was deeply involved in the figure skating community, with Spencer’s parents supporting his skating journey.
